The word "corner" generally, however not always, refers to a 90 degree angle. In geometry, nevertheless, the term "angle" is really a point where two lines or sides meet (or converge). These points are called vertex, and they can be straight or curved.
Using a curved mitre in an image structure, as an example, calls for mindful estimation. The mitre angle is based upon the size proportion of the board at each edge. If the boards are of equal size, then they will each call for a 45 degree mitre. If the boards are broader, then they will each call for a different angle. This circumstance is common in custom-made frames, where the leading and bottom rails are typically bigger than the side rails.
